The US Energy Trading and Risk Management (ETRM) market has experienced significant growth in recent years, driven by the increasing complexity of energy markets and the need for businesses to better manage risks and optimize trading strategies. ETRM solutions provide the necessary tools for companies involved in energy trading to efficiently handle and mitigate risks associated with volatile energy prices, regulatory changes, and operational inefficiencies. These systems enable market participants, including utilities, oil and gas firms, and renewable energy companies, to effectively monitor, analyze, and manage trading and risk activities.
The demand for ETRM solutions is primarily driven by the rapidly evolving energy landscape. As energy markets become more interconnected and competitive, companies require advanced risk management tools to navigate financial uncertainties. ETRM systems help businesses with price forecasting, managing commodity exposure, regulatory compliance, and optimizing trading strategies. The ability to predict market trends and react quickly to changes can provide a significant advantage in a highly competitive industry.
Industries that rely on the US Energy Trading and Risk Management (ETRM) market, such as oil, gas, power, and renewable energy, have specific requirements for these solutions. Energy companies often need real-time data, predictive analytics, and customizable features to suit their unique risk management needs. ETRM systems must also support a wide range of functionalities, including trade lifecycle management, transaction tracking, position management, and reporting capabilities. Additionally, these solutions must comply with industry regulations and ensure that firms are not exposed to compliance risks.
The integ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ning into ETRM systems is also a growing trend. These technologies enable more accurate predictions of market fluctuations and offer improved risk mitigation strategies. AI-driven models can learn from historical data and optimize trading decisions, leading to enhanced profitability and reduced exposure to risk.
